Another significant area of focus for the Chinese robotics industry is the enhancing application of collaborative robots, commonly described as cobots. These robots are created to function along with human operators in a shared work area, carrying out a variety of jobs from material managing to setting up help. The implementation of cobots represents a shift in exactly how services in China view robotic innovation; as opposed to seeing robots as a replacement for human labor, firms are starting to harness them as companions that can boost human capacities and enhance safety. The surge of cobots in China can be connected to their capacity to simplify complex tasks, making it possible for firms to optimize workforce efficiency without the demand for considerable re-training or process redesign.
A notable statistics that illustrates the improvement in China's robotics capacity is the robot density in the nation's manufacturing industries. Robot density describes the number of robots per 10,000 staff members in a particular market. According to recent stats, China has actually made considerable progression in enhancing its robot density, leading the globe in terms of complete industrial robot installations. This boost plays a crucial function in keeping the balance between labor demands and technical development, making sure that China remains to be a popular manufacturing center on a global scale. As the globe's largest market for industrial robots, China's growth trajectory signals both an action to residential labor shortages and a positive strategy to improving performance through automation.
